The DC AC Clean Room Ceiling HEPA Box Fan with H14 Laminar Flow Hood Filter Unit combines industrial-grade durability with precision filtration for critical environments. Engineered for high-capacity air movement, it features a robust metal chassis, dual-voltage operation (DC/AC), and customizable airflow parameters to meet stringent cleanroom or industrial standards.
